On August 28, 2025, Fertsy Inc (hereinafter “Fertsy”), Chengdu Jinxin Information Technology Co., Ltd. (hereinafter “Jinxin Technology”), and Sichuan Jinxin Xinan Women’s and Children’s Hospital (hereinafter “Jinxin Xinan”) formally signed a strategic cooperation agreement in Chengdu. The three parties will engage in comprehensive cooperation on the deep application of artificial intelligence in assisted reproduction, jointly promoting the intelligent development of embryo laboratories and the improvement of clinical success rates.

Laboratory Director Meng Xiangqian of Jinxin Xinan Women’s and Children’s Hospital (center), General Manager Wang Weipeng of Jinxin Technology (right), and Deputy General Manager Huang Haosi of Fertsy (left) jointly sign the strategic cooperation agreement between Fertsy and Jinxin.

Fertsy is an internationally leading startup dedicated to artificial intelligence in assisted reproduction, founded by AI and information systems experts who graduated from the Department of Electronic Engineering at Tsinghua University and have worked for many years at globally renowned companies such as Huawei, Microsoft, and Baidu. In collaboration with top-tier assisted reproduction physician teams at home and abroad, Fertsy has jointly developed a series of AI-powered embryo assessment and laboratory quality control software and hardware systems, committed to using technological innovation to improve the success rate and accessibility of assisted reproduction while reducing error rates.

Jinxin Reproductive Group (01951.HK) is committed to building an internationally leading comprehensive assisted reproduction service system. In 2021, it incubated Jinxin Technology as a key information technology platform to deepen the R&D and application transformation of core assisted reproduction technologies. Leveraging the Group’s extensive clinical and laboratory resources at home and abroad, and using Jinxin Xinan Hospital (Bisheng Campus) as the product incubation base hospital, Jinxin Technology continuously promotes the standardization, intelligentization, and internationalization of reproductive medicine technology through information technology. Its self-developed digital products and integrated solutions—including the EMR obstetrics and assisted reproduction electronic medical record system, the HSCRM medical customer service operation system, and the women’s health and fertility AI agent—have been widely adopted by dozens of medical institutions both domestically and internationally.

According to the agreement, Fertsy and Jinxin Technology will conduct joint R&D and clinical validation at the Jinxin Xinan embryo laboratory. The collaboration covers multiple areas, including the application of artificial intelligence in embryo screening, laboratory quality control management, and intelligent workflow management. The three parties will fully leverage their respective technological, clinical, and resource advantages to accelerate the clinical translation of research outcomes, delivering assisted reproduction medical solutions with higher success rates, greater safety, and enhanced personalization to patients.
